Is Mean Corpuscular Hemoglobin Concentration (MCHC) 36.6 g/dL Low, Normal, or High?
Mean Corpuscular Hemoglobin Concentration (MCHC) 36.6 g/dL might be considered at the upper end of typical reference ranges or slightly elevated. Most laboratories define a normal range for MCHC to be between approximately 32 and 36 g/dL, though these ranges can vary slightly. Therefore, a result of 36.6 g/dL is just a little above this general guideline. It's not usually a cause for immediate alarm, but rather an invitation to understand more about your red blood cells and their characteristics.
| Mean Corpuscular Hemoglobin Concentration (MCHC) Range | Values |
|---|---|
| Low (Hypochromic) | Below 32.0 g/dL |
| Normal | 32.0 - 36.0 g/dL |
| High (Possible Spherocytosis) | 36.1 - 40.0 g/dL |

What Does a Mean Corpuscular Hemoglobin Concentration (MCHC) Level of 36.6 g/dL Mean?
The Mean Corpuscular Hemoglobin Concentration (MCHC) is a valuable piece of information from a complete blood count, offering insight into the health and characteristics of your red blood cells. To understand what an MCHC of 36.6 g/dL means, let's first break down the term. Hemoglobin is the protein inside red blood cells responsible for carrying oxygen from your lungs to the rest of your body, and bringing carbon dioxide back. The 'concentration' part refers to how densely packed this hemoglobin is within each red blood cell. Essentially, the MCHC tells us about the average saturation of hemoglobin in your red blood cells, which can be thought of as how 'colorful' or 'full' these cells are with oxygen-carrying pigment. A result of 36.6 g/dL for your Mean Corpuscular Hemoglobin Concentration suggests that your red blood cells are quite full of hemoglobin, possibly even slightly more densely packed than what's typically observed. This value indicates that your red blood cells are considered 'hyperchromic,' meaning they have a higher than average concentration of hemoglobin. While this sounds quite technical, in plain terms, it means your red blood cells are efficient oxygen carriers in terms of their hemoglobin content. It's one of several markers healthcare providers use to assess red blood cell health, working in conjunction with other numbers like the red blood cell count, hemoglobin amount, hematocrit, and mean corpuscular volume (MCV).
